From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752273AbYJUQSk (ORCPT ); Tue, 21 Oct 2008 12:18:40 -0400 Received: (majordomo@vger.kernel.org) by vger.kernel.org id S1752088AbYJUQSR (ORCPT ); Tue, 21 Oct 2008 12:18:17 -0400 Received: from e4.ny.us.ibm.com ([32.97.182.144]:39555 "EHLO e4.ny.us.ibm.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751983AbYJUQSQ (ORCPT ); Tue, 21 Oct 2008 12:18:16 -0400 Date: Tue, 21 Oct 2008 09:18:12 -0700 From: "Paul E. McKenney" To: Steven Rostedt Cc: Mathieu Desnoyers , LKML , Ingo Molnar , Thomas Gleixner , Peter Zijlstra , Andrew Morton , Linus Torvalds Subject: Re: Lockup in tracepoint unregister in sched switch ftrace plugin Message-ID: <20081021161812.GC6853@linux.vnet.ibm.com> Reply-To: paulmck@linux.vnet.ibm.com References: M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: User-Agent: Mutt/1.5.15+20070412 (2007-04-11)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Tue, Oct 21, 2008 at 12:14:03AM -0400, Steven Rostedt wrote: > > > [ Paul, Thomas, wake up ] I am awake, but fortunately for me, Ingo woke up before I did. ;-) (Sorry, couldn't resist...) Thanx, Paul > On Mon, 20 Oct 2008, Steven Rostedt wrote: > > > > which calls unregister_trace_sched_switch define as macro to: > > > > kernel/tracepoint.c: tracepoint_probe_unregister > > " " : remove_tracepoint > > kernel/rcupdate.c: rcu_barrier_sched > > " " : _rcu_barrier > > > > where it gets stuck at that "wait_for_completion". > > > > I'm not sure if, because this is a scheduler trace point that we are > > hitting some kind of race that is preventing the wait_for_completion to > > finish, or what. > > Note, I just booted this kernel with CONFIG_NOHZ=n and it booted fine. > This looks like a bug somewhere in tracepoints/RCU/dynamic-ticks > > -- Steve >